    417: AI: A New Kind of Being #3: What if AI chose you to help save the world?

    28/07/2026 | 53 min
    After surviving decades of illness, addiction, and abandonment before finally uncovering the rare condition that shaped his life, a man believes an extraordinary encounter with an AI entity gives him a new mission and returns him to the person he was always meant to be.

    416: AI: A New Kind of Being #2: What if your AI betrayed you?

    21/07/2026 | 59 min
    After a lifetime of feeling like she didn’t belong, a writer and technologist turns to AI for connection, but when it promises her reunion with her soulmate of many lifetimes, she must reckon with the fragile line between delusion and hope.

    415: AI: A New Kind of Being #1: What if you married your AI?

    14/07/2026 | 53 min
    After a man builds a life rooted in family and tradition, the sudden death of his son shakes him to the core, but through a deep relationship with a beloved AI companion he’s moved to confront the depths of grief and the changing boundaries of love.

    414: What if you could never be the ice princess they wanted?

    07/07/2026 | 1 h 3 min
    After becoming a teenage figure skating champion and Olympic athlete, a woman is broken open by grief, fame, addiction, and shame, but through motherhood, reinvention, and a return to the ice, she begins to stitch together the person and performer she was never allowed to fully become.

Acerca de This Is Actually Happening
What if you were trafficked into a cult...or were mauled by a grizzly bear...or were stabbed 27 times by a serial killer - what would you do? This is Actually Happening brings you extraordinary true stories of life-changing events told by the people who lived them. From a man who woke up in the morgue to a woman stranded in a Mexican desert fighting to survive, these stories will have you on the edge of your seat waiting to hear what happens next.Audible subscribers can listen to all episodes of This Is Actually Happening ad-free right now.
